Output 3fd708bb14a2d15a25b762b7a56b65b80209f9c8ff077e25e8a56ddd900fe203:1

value
28053028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79a1863c788d02fbbb02f3645ebbaf33f255244a OP_EQUAL
address
3Cn9BfVk1w2XQQJammyGGHzrVH6L1FEgoR
transaction
3fd708bb14a2d15a25b762b7a56b65b80209f9c8ff077e25e8a56ddd900fe203
confirmations
326588
spent
true